T.I. and Lil Wayne

On last night’s episode of “T.I. & Tiny: The Family Hustle,” Tip paid a visit to Chicago’s WGCI to preview “Ball,” his highly-anticipated collaboration with Lil Wayne off his upcoming album Trouble Man (Dec. 18). A snippet of the New Orleans bounce record can be heard in the video clip below.

“It’s a dope record. It’s high energy, party, Southern club, fancy shit,” T.I. told staging-rapup.kinsta.cloud, while producer Rico Love added, “I know we got a bonafide club banger with that one.”

In addition to Weezy, the album is expected to feature collaborations with André 3000, R. Kelly, A$AP Rocky, and Cee Lo Green.
